How to Convert Cubic Centimeter to Quart

1 cubic centimeter = 0.00105669 quarts

Quart = Cubic Centimeter × 0.00105669

Example: 267 cm³ × 0.00105669 = 0.28214 qt

Reverse Conversion

To convert quarts back to cubic centimeters:

  • Remember, 1 quart equals 946.353 cubic centimeters.
  • To convert 0.28214 qt to cm³, multiply 0.28214 x 946.353, resulting in 267 cm³.
